The festival will return to Suffolk for its 15th edition from July 16-19, revealing a typically eclectic line-up covering music, comedy, spoken word and more.
The Lumineers, Michael Kiwanuka, Keane and Charli XCX have also been confirmed for the four-day event, with further bookings including Phoebe Bridgers, Marika Hackman and Local Natives.
Elsewhere, comedian Bill Bailey will be in attendance, as will Charlie Mackesy and Dr John Cooper Clarke. The Stormzy-led imprint #Merky Books will also be represented at the festival.
